La Liga 2003-04 season, the 73rd since its establishment, started on August 30, 2003 and finished on May 23, 2004.

[edit] Final table
| P | Club | Pld | W | D | L | GF | GA | Pts | GD | Comments |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Valencia CF | 38 | 23 | 8 | 7 | 71 | 27 | 77 | +44 | Champion of La Liga UEFA Champions League |
| 2 | FC Barcelona | 38 | 21 | 9 | 8 | 63 | 39 | 72 | +24 | UEFA Champions League |
| 3 | Deportivo de La Coruña | 38 | 21 | 8 | 9 | 60 | 34 | 71 | +26 | UEFA Champions League Third qualifying round |
| 4 | Real Madrid | 38 | 21 | 7 | 10 | 72 | 54 | 70 | +18 | UEFA Champions League Third qualifying round |
| 5 | Athletic Bilbao | 38 | 15 | 11 | 12 | 53 | 49 | 56 | +4 | UEFA Cup |
| 6 | Sevilla FC | 38 | 15 | 10 | 13 | 56 | 45 | 55 | +11 | UEFA Cup |
| 7 | Atlético Madrid | 38 | 15 | 10 | 13 | 51 | 53 | 55 | -2 | UEFA Intertoto Cup |
| 8 | Villarreal CF | 38 | 15 | 9 | 14 | 47 | 49 | 54 | -2 | UEFA Intertoto Cup |
| 9 | Betis | 38 | 13 | 13 | 12 | 46 | 43 | 52 | +3 | |
| 10 | Málaga CF | 38 | 15 | 6 | 17 | 50 | 55 | 51 | -5 | |
| 11 | RCD Mallorca | 38 | 15 | 6 | 17 | 54 | 66 | 51 | -12 | |
| 12 | Zaragoza | 38 | 13 | 9 | 16 | 46 | 55 | 48 | -9 | UEFA Cup (winner of Copa del Rey) |
| 13 | Osasuna | 38 | 11 | 15 | 12 | 38 | 37 | 48 | +1 | |
| 14 | Albacete | 38 | 13 | 8 | 17 | 40 | 48 | 47 | -8 | |
| 15 | Real Sociedad | 38 | 11 | 13 | 14 | 49 | 53 | 46 | -4 | |
| 16 | Racing de Santander | 38 | 11 | 10 | 17 | 48 | 63 | 43 | -15 | |
| 17 | RCD Espanyol | 38 | 13 | 4 | 21 | 48 | 64 | 43 | -16 | |
| 18 | Valladolid | 38 | 10 | 11 | 17 | 46 | 56 | 41 | -10 | Relegated to Segunda División |
| 19 | Celta de Vigo | 38 | 9 | 12 | 17 | 48 | 68 | 39 | -20 | Relegated to Segunda División |
| 20 | Murcia | 38 | 5 | 11 | 22 | 29 | 57 | 26 | -28 | Relegated to Segunda División |
